Descriptive writing is writing that describes people, places, animals or objects in such a way that allows readers to build strong images in their mind. We can do this by using vivid verbs, precise adjectives and by including multiple senses in our descriptions. Watch our ... WebExercise 1. Decide on an everyday action, say ‘making a pot of coffee’ and write about it in a descriptive manner. Give yourself 3 words that you’re not allowed to use while writing about it. WebExercise 1: Timed Writing. Set a timer for 20 minutes. Write about one of the following topics. Be sure to fully address the prompt. Remember to practice prewriting and revising within the time limit.Your response should be between 250-300 words. Describe an important place for you personally.
